客戶多樣性指的是存在多個軟件實現(稱為客戶端)連接並運行於以太坊網絡中。每個客戶端都是遵循以太坊協議的不同版本軟件,可能具有獨特的功能、優化或修復漏洞。常見的客戶端包括 Geth、Parity(現為 OpenEthereum)和 Nethermind。這種多樣性確保沒有單一實現佔據主導地位或成為整個網絡的關鍵漏洞點。
在節點上運行多個不同的客戶端有助於增強去中心化,避免對單一代碼庫的依賴。同時,它鼓勵創新,因為不同團隊可以嘗試新功能而不會同時危及所有節點的穩定性。此外,多元化的客戶端實現有助於更快識別錯誤或安全漏洞,因為問題較不可能局限於某一個特定客户端。
客戶多樣性的主要好處在於它提升了網絡安全和韌性。當某一款客户端被發現存在漏洞時,只要其他客户端未受影響,就不會威脅到整個網絡。這種冗餘機制作為防範潛在攻擊的重要保障,可以避免共識被破壞或出現分裂。
此外,多元化的客户端促進了系統堅韌度,使得在不同環境和硬體配置下持續測試成為可能,加速安全協議和性能優化方面的改進——這些都是維持像以太坊這類去中心化網絡可信度的重要因素。
多客服設置指的是在單一節點或節點群組上同時運行數款不同的以太坊客户端。此做法帶來若干操作上的優勢:
透過部署多客服配置,節點運營者可以大幅提升正常運作時間,同時降低由特定实现缺陷引發風險。
從 Ethereum 1.0(工作量證明)轉向 Ethereum 2.0(權益證明)的過程中,引入了新的機制如分片技術——將資料拆分成較小部分,以及旨在提高容錯能力的新型 PoS 共識算法,以進一步增強可擴展性與韌性。
此外,包括 Geth(2015年推出)、Parity/OpenEthereum(2017年)、Nethermind(2019年)等核心客户端的不斷開發,也展示出社群致力於通過 Ethereum 客户端規範 (ECS) 等倡議來改善互操作標準。这些努力旨在確保各实现之間能無縫通信,同時保持高安全標準。
社群參與仍然至關重要;討論最佳部署實踐幫助塑造政策,以鞏固去中心化原則,同時應對管理各種設定所帶來之操作複雜性的挑戰。
儘管具有許多好處,但這些策略也伴隨一些挑戰:
操作複雜度:管理不同類型的软件需要專業技術;配置失誤可能引入潛藏風險。
資源需求:同時運行數款客户端會增加硬體要求,如 CPU、記憶體、存儲空間——相應地也提高成本。
互通問題:確保各实现之間順暢通信需嚴格遵守共同標準;若出現差異,可能導致同步困難甚至分叉情況產生。
解決上述挑戰需要社群持續合作推動標準制定,以及改良工具,使部署與維護更便捷高效。
以下幾個重要日期彰顯區塊鏈開發者如何逐步建立起更具彈性的架構:
2015年7月:Ethereum 主鏈正式啟動,踏入去中心金融領域。
2020年12月:「ETH 2.0」信標鏈啟動,是邁向利用權益證明機制提升可擴展性的關鍵一步。
2015年至2023年期間,包括 Geth 的早期版本發布、Parity 演變成 OpenEthereum 等,都奠定了堅固且具備彈性的基礎架構基石。
這些里程碑反映出產業不僅追求創新,也積極透過策略如分散式架構來保障其核心技術免受未來威脅侵害。
總結而言, 客户端 多样化 和 多客服設置 在加強以太坊去中心化結構方面扮演著不可或缺的重要角色,它們提供故障冗餘、促進創新、多元代碼庫合作以及長遠可持續發展所必需,是面對快速演變科技環境下的重要保障元素。
Lo
2025-05-14 19:51
客戶多樣性和多客戶設置在以太坊(ETH)網絡的韌性中扮演什麼角色?
客戶多樣性指的是存在多個軟件實現(稱為客戶端)連接並運行於以太坊網絡中。每個客戶端都是遵循以太坊協議的不同版本軟件,可能具有獨特的功能、優化或修復漏洞。常見的客戶端包括 Geth、Parity(現為 OpenEthereum)和 Nethermind。這種多樣性確保沒有單一實現佔據主導地位或成為整個網絡的關鍵漏洞點。
在節點上運行多個不同的客戶端有助於增強去中心化,避免對單一代碼庫的依賴。同時,它鼓勵創新,因為不同團隊可以嘗試新功能而不會同時危及所有節點的穩定性。此外,多元化的客戶端實現有助於更快識別錯誤或安全漏洞,因為問題較不可能局限於某一個特定客户端。
客戶多樣性的主要好處在於它提升了網絡安全和韌性。當某一款客户端被發現存在漏洞時,只要其他客户端未受影響,就不會威脅到整個網絡。這種冗餘機制作為防範潛在攻擊的重要保障,可以避免共識被破壞或出現分裂。
此外,多元化的客户端促進了系統堅韌度,使得在不同環境和硬體配置下持續測試成為可能,加速安全協議和性能優化方面的改進——這些都是維持像以太坊這類去中心化網絡可信度的重要因素。
多客服設置指的是在單一節點或節點群組上同時運行數款不同的以太坊客户端。此做法帶來若干操作上的優勢:
透過部署多客服配置,節點運營者可以大幅提升正常運作時間,同時降低由特定实现缺陷引發風險。
從 Ethereum 1.0(工作量證明)轉向 Ethereum 2.0(權益證明)的過程中,引入了新的機制如分片技術——將資料拆分成較小部分,以及旨在提高容錯能力的新型 PoS 共識算法,以進一步增強可擴展性與韌性。
此外,包括 Geth(2015年推出)、Parity/OpenEthereum(2017年)、Nethermind(2019年)等核心客户端的不斷開發,也展示出社群致力於通過 Ethereum 客户端規範 (ECS) 等倡議來改善互操作標準。这些努力旨在確保各实现之間能無縫通信,同時保持高安全標準。
社群參與仍然至關重要;討論最佳部署實踐幫助塑造政策,以鞏固去中心化原則,同時應對管理各種設定所帶來之操作複雜性的挑戰。
儘管具有許多好處,但這些策略也伴隨一些挑戰:
操作複雜度:管理不同類型的软件需要專業技術;配置失誤可能引入潛藏風險。
資源需求:同時運行數款客户端會增加硬體要求,如 CPU、記憶體、存儲空間——相應地也提高成本。
互通問題:確保各实现之間順暢通信需嚴格遵守共同標準;若出現差異,可能導致同步困難甚至分叉情況產生。
解決上述挑戰需要社群持續合作推動標準制定,以及改良工具,使部署與維護更便捷高效。
以下幾個重要日期彰顯區塊鏈開發者如何逐步建立起更具彈性的架構:
2015年7月:Ethereum 主鏈正式啟動,踏入去中心金融領域。
2020年12月:「ETH 2.0」信標鏈啟動,是邁向利用權益證明機制提升可擴展性的關鍵一步。
2015年至2023年期間,包括 Geth 的早期版本發布、Parity 演變成 OpenEthereum 等,都奠定了堅固且具備彈性的基礎架構基石。
這些里程碑反映出產業不僅追求創新,也積極透過策略如分散式架構來保障其核心技術免受未來威脅侵害。
總結而言, 客户端 多样化 和 多客服設置 在加強以太坊去中心化結構方面扮演著不可或缺的重要角色,它們提供故障冗餘、促進創新、多元代碼庫合作以及長遠可持續發展所必需,是面對快速演變科技環境下的重要保障元素。
免責聲明:含第三方內容,非財務建議。
詳見《條款和條件》